Do you have to disconnect the battery change a rear wheel sensor on 1999 dodge Dakota?

You don't *have* to disconnect the battery to change a rear wheel speed sensor on a 1999 Dodge Dakota, but it's generally recommended as a safety precaution. The risk of accidentally shorting something out is low, but disconnecting the battery eliminates that risk entirely. It also prevents any potential issues with the ABS system while working.

While the job itself doesn't inherently require it, disconnecting the battery adds a layer of safety and simplifies the process by ensuring the electrical system is completely de-energized. It's a quick and easy step that minimizes the chance of complications.
